Ten Cupcakes You Need To Try

Not Necessarily in any order...

Choc Peppermint Cupcakes.

1 cup SR Flour
1/2 cup Sugar
2tbls Cocoa
2 eggs
90g butter or marg
1/2 cup Chocolate (melted)
1 tsp Peppermint essence
2-3tbls milk

Mix all ingredients (except chocolate) with electric mixer until smooth.
Stir through melted chocolate.
Divide evenly between 12 cupcake cases.
Cook at 180 C (160 fan forced) for 20 mins

Makes 12
                                                                                                                  
White Chocolate Strawberry Cupcakes

1 cup SR Flour
1/2 cup Sugar
2tbls Cocoa
2 eggs
90g butter or marg
1/2 cup  White Chocolate (melted)
2 tsp Strawberry essence
2-3tbls milk
Extra White Choc bits (optional)

Mix all ingredients (except chocolate) with electric mixer until smooth.
Stir through melted chocolate.
Stir through Choc bits (Optional)
Divide evenly between 12 cupcake cases.
Cook at 180 C (160 fan forced) for 20 mins

Makes 12

Variation: Add Fresh Strawberries, Chopped
                                                                                                                   
I like to use White Chocolate Ganche. Mostly because I am loving the taste of it at the moment!
You could also you Buttercream or any other icing recipe!
White Chocolate Ganche

 250g White chocolate, chopped
 1/3 cup cream

Combine chocolate and cream in a heatproof bowl over a saucepan of simmering water.
Stir with a metal spoon until smooth. Remove bowl from heat.
Set aside at room temperature to cool, stirring occasionally, until ganache is thick and spreadable.

For Mint: add 3-4 drops of peppermint essence, to taste, and 1-2 drops of green colouring

Creating A Blog

 This is a blog about creating blogs, as since I posted my blog on Facebook, a couple of people have wanted to create their own, but have had trouble doing co.

So here we go:

1.Creating a Blog

a) Go to:  https://www.blogger.com/start

b) Click the big organce button that says Create a blog.

c) Enter your details, and Pick Your Display Name.(Who do u want your post froms?)

d) Name your blog. and pick your (normally the same, if its available)

e) Choose a template: To start with, just pick one that looks ok to you. You can always change templates or personalise them later

f) Next, Write a post:
Anything really, perhaps start with an introduction of yourself, your family if u plan to include them in your posts (maybe nicknames if u prefer not to mention real names), and what you are all about...Hobbies, what you hope to blog about etc.

Thats it!


2. Navigating Your Way Around

The top right hand side of the screen has "Dashboard" link.
This is pretty much your homepage. This is where you can view posts, make new posts, edit your profile, etc

From there, its up to you.
You can edit your profile to include info about yourself and maybe a picture. These will be visible at the side of your Blog. (My profile picture is of my girls)



Writing a Post

On your dashboard, click New Post.

Title it,
and then write. Whatever you want to!!

When your ready, preview it, and click publish post.
Easy! And you can edit it later if you want, by clicking 'Edit Post' back at your dashboard.

Sharing Your Blog
When you're ready to start sharing your blog with the world, the URL that you typed in back in step 1d, Thats what you give people. 
It should be "titleofyourblog.blogspot.com"
If your not sure, comment on my blog when your signed in, and I'll tell you what it is.
